People who are physically dependent to drugs or alcohol and want assistance will initially go through detoxification before receiving other treatment services in drug rehab. Detox is basically the procedure of the drug being eradicated from one's system, which is often uncomfortable and may hold risks if not carried out in a setting which can offer appropriate support and medical intervention as needed. Detoxification services are provided at either a professional drug or alcohol detox facility or a drug rehab facility which can appropriately oversee and supply medical supervision for persons who are just coming off of drugs. Detoxification services often include insuring the individual is as comfortable as possible while detoxing and going through drug or alcohol withdrawal, supplying proper nutrition and ensuring the particular person is receiving proper rest, and providing supplements and medicine as necessary to make the detox process as easy and safe as possible. The individual in detoxification will sometimes be encouraged to take part in some form of physical activity such as walking, yoga, etc. At a drug detox facility or drug treatment facility which can provide detox services, the person will have detox staff at their disposal around the clock to make certain that any issues are handled as quickly and safely as possible.
